23
1 Architecture de l'ordinateur Architecture de Architecture de l'ordinateur l'ordinateur Tél : 066950863

Architecture Ordinateur 2008 p1

Embed Size (px)

Citation preview

Page 1: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 1/23

Page 2: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 2/23

2

Introduction

1. L’informatiqueEst une science qui s’occupe du traitement automatique de l’information.

La base de cette science c’est l’information. Qui est un langage binaire, Elle comporte 0,1 (binaire)

2. Ordinateur (computer)

C’est une machine électronique capable de traiter l’information

Un ordinateur est un ensemble de circuit électronique permettant de manipuler des données sous formes

binaire,Toute machine capable de manipuler les informations binaires peut être qualifié d’ordinateur.

Page 3: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 3/23

Page 4: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 4/23

4

Utilisateur Système d’exploitation Ordinateur

Ordinateur = matériel + logicielHard Soft

en 1984

et en 1998...

Page 5: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 5/23

5

1) Partie logicielle

1. Programme informatique

Un programme informatique est constitué d'une suite d'instructions (ou ordres) exécutées par l'ordinateur pour

accomplir une tâche particulière.

2. Langages de programmation

Comme pour les langues naturelles (Français, Anglais, Russe, Chinois, etc.), il existe un grand nombre de langages de

programmation. Certains sont adaptés à des domaines particuliers, d'autres dépendent de certains types d'ordinateurs, etc.

3. Exemples de langages de programmation

Basic (simple et très limité)

Fortran (domaines scientifiques)Pascal (langage structuré, efficace pour les structures arborescentes)C (efficace pour le traitement des chaînes de caractères)Visual Basic (langage orienté objet, interfaces graphiques)Java (efficace pour des programmes en rapport avec Internet)

Page 6: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 6/23

6

4. Systèmes d'exploitation (Anglais: operating system, OS)

Pour qu’un ordinateur soit capable de faire fonctionner un programme, il faut que la machine puisse effectuer un certain

nombre d’opération préparatoire pour assurer les échanges d’information entre l’unité centrale et la mémoire et certain

périphérique. C’est le système d’exploitation qui assure ces tâches.

C’est un système qui établit les liens entre le matériel, l’utilisateur et les applications (traitement de texte, jeux…).

D’autre part le système d’exploitation fournit un certain nombre d’outils pour gérer la machine. Il assure l’initialisation

du système, gère les périphériques, en assurant des opérations aussi simples que l’affichage des caractères à l’écran ou

bien la lecture du clavier, mais aussi le pilotage d’une imprimante ou d’un scanner.

C ’est un ensemble des programmes qui permet à exploiter les ressources matérielles

MS DOS ( MicroSoft Disk Operating System): pour PCMicrosoft Windows 3.x, Windows 95, 98, NT, 2000, XP,2003 : pour PC, mais plus convivial que MS DOSMac OS : pour MacintoshUNIX, LINUX : pour PC

5. Exemples

Page 7: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 7/23

7

Les premiers Systèmes d'Exploitation sur PC fonctionnaient en mode texte, à la différence du Mac OS qui avait adopté

dès 83 une interface graphique.

Les interfaces graphiques se sont généralisées sur PC à partir de 1990 (Windows 2, 3, 3.1, 95, 98,)

Microsoft détient un quasi monopole des systèmes d'exploitation sur PC. Mais il existe aussi un système d'exploitation

concurrent, appelé Linux, développé à l’origine par un étudiant finlandais, Linus

Page 8: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 8/23

8

6. Le concept d'interface graphique

Contrairement à ce qu'on pourrait croire, ce concept est assez ancien et remonte aux années 60

1968 : Douglas C. Engelbart de la Stanford Research Institute fait une démonstration d'un environnement graphique avecdes fenêtres à manipuler avec une souris. Il démontre dans cet environnement l'utilisation d'un traitement de texte,d'un système hypertexte et d'un logiciel de travail collaboratif en groupe.

1973 : Le premier prototype opérationnel de la station de travail Xerox Alto

1970 : Des chercheurs du PARC (Palo Alto Research Center), créé par la société Rank Xerox; mènent des recherches à long terme,sans visées d'applications commerciales. C'est là que furent imaginés les concepts de bureau électronique, de zone de travail, de

fenêtre, d'icône, etc. On utilise la souris, ce petit boîtier électronique qui permet de déplacer sur l'écran.

La station de travail conçue au PARC utilise le langage orienté objet SmallTalk, une interface graphique, une souris et peut être

mise en réseau via Ethernet.

1975 : Le premier traitement de texte WYSIWYG (What You See Is What You Get) développé au PARC sur Xerox Alto

1981 : Pour essayer de tirer parti de toutes les bonnes idées mises au point avec l'Alto, Xerox commercialise le Star 8010,une machine qui intègre déjà une interface entièrement graphique utilisant au maximum le "Drag & Drop", le copier-coller

1983 : Apple présente un nouvel ordinateur exceptionnel : le Lisa (Local Integrated Software Architecture). C'est le premierordinateur personnel à interface graphique. Mais du fait de son prix, cette machine rencontrera un succès limité(100000 exemplaires vendus).

Page 9: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 9/23

9

1984 : Commercialisation de l'Apple Macintosh au grand public. Comme le Lisa, le Macintosh s'utilise entièrement à la souris grâceà son interface graphique. Son prix plus raisonnable de $ 2500 (15000 F) permettra à la machine de remporter un grand succès.La simplicité de manipulation de l'interface graphique grâce à la présence de la souris autorisait n'importe qui à manipuler unordinateur sans connaissances préalables, ce qui était loin d'être le cas pour un PC.

1984 : Digital Research commercialise son interface graphique GEM pour IBM PC.

1985 : Devant le succès du Macintosh, Microsoft met enfin sur le marché, au prix de $ 100, une modeste interface graphiquequ'il appelle Windows (fenêtres), parce que le concept de fenêtre y jouait un rôle primordial ; la version 1, trop timide, est un échec,mais Windows s'améliore au fil des versions et se substituera au vieux MS-DOS à partir de la version Windows 95. Ce système

d'exploitation, flanqué d'Internet Explorer depuis la version 98, est livré "par défaut" avec tout PC,

A partir de 1991, le Web va offrir à Internet une dimension graphique.

7 Les logiciels d'application

Page 10: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 10/23

10

7. Les logiciels d application

Ensemble de programmes coopérant pour exécuter une tâche particulière

C’est un ensemble de programmes dédier à un travail bien déterminé

8. Types et exemples de logiciels

Type de logiciel Définition Exemples

Edition de textesSaisie de textes simples, sans mise en page

sophistiquée.

Bloc-notes (PC),

SimpleText (MAC),

Traitement de textesSaisie de texte avec mise en page sophistiquée,

insertion d'images et de tableaux, etc.

Word

(version actuelle Word 2000).

Logiciels graphiques Dessins et images

Paint Shop Pro (PC)

Adobe Photoshop (PC et Mac)

Adobe Illustrator (PC et Mac)

TableurRéalisation de tableaux de calculs (factures,

bulletins de salaire, etc.)

Lotus

Excel

Logiciels de Bases de

Données

Réalisation de listes structurées d'éléments et

leur exploitation.

DBase (PC)

4eDimension (Mac et PC)

Access (PC)

SGBDSystème de gestion de bases de données :

logiciel puissant pour la gestion et

l'interrogation des bases de données.

Oracle

Sybase

Ingres, ...

Logiciels intégrésLogiciels incluant à la fois des fonctionnalités

de traitement de texte, dessin, tableur et

base de données.

Microsoft WorksClaris Works

Page 11: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 11/23

11

9. Un mot sur le multimédia

Par analogie aux médias de l'information:

• Presse écrite (texte)• Radio (son)• Magazines (image fixe)• Télévision (image vidéo)

Un ordinateur est dit multimédia s'il peut traiter et stocker des textes, des sons, des images fixes

et des images vidéos.

2) P ti M té i ll

Page 12: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 12/23

12

2) Partie Matérielle

1) Histoire de l'informatique (matériel)

Par nature paresseux, l'homme a toujours cherché à simplifier et améliorer sa façon de calculer, à la fois pour limiterses erreurs et gagner du temps.

- 1500 av. J.C. (?) : Le Boulier. Il est toujours utilisé dans certains pays.

- en 1641 : La Pascaline (machine à calculer de Blaise PASCAL)

1937 l M k I d'IBM t d l l 5 f i l it l'h Il t tit é d 3300

Page 13: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 13/23

13

- en 1937 : le Mark I d'IBM permet de calculer 5 fois plus vite que l'homme. Il est constitué de 3300engrenages, 1400 commutateurs et 800 km de fil. Les engrenages seront remplacés en 1947 par descomposants électroniques.

- en 1943 : Colossus I

Composé de 1 500 lampes et d'un lecteur de bandes capable de lire 5000 caractères à la seconde,ce calculateur électronique anglais a été conçu pour décoder des messages chiffrés.

- en 1947 : invention du transistor

- en 1948 : UNIVAC (UNIVersal Automatic Computer)

Il utilise des bandes magnétiques en remplacement des

cartes perforées. Il est composé de 5000 tubes, sa

mémoire est de 1000 mots de 12 bits, il peut réaliser 8333

additions ou 555 multiplications par seconde. Sa superficie

au sol est de 25m².

Page 14: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 14/23

14

- en 1958 : mise au point du circuit intégré, qui permet de réduire encore la taille et le coût des ordinateurs

- en 1960 : l'IBM 7000, premier ordinateur à base de transistors.

- en 1972 : l'Intel 4004 ; premier microprocesseur, voit le jour.

- en 1980 : l'ordinateur familial

- en 1981 : IBM-PC (Personnal Computer)

Page 15: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 15/23

15

2. Modélisation

Page 16: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 16/23

16

Page 17: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 17/23

17

3. Présentation du binaire

Vers la fin des années 30, Claude Shannon démontra qu'à l'aide de « contacteurs » (interrupteurs) fermés pour « vrai »

et ouverts pour « faux » il était possible d'effectuer des opérations logiques en associant le nombre 1 pour « vrai » et 0

pour « faux ».

Ce langage est nommé langage binaire. C'est avec ce langage que fonctionnent les ordinateurs. Il permet d'utiliser deux

chiffres (0 et 1) pour faire des nombres.

4. Le bit

Le terme bit signifie « binary digit », c'est-à-dire 0 ou 1 en numérotation binaire. Il s'agit de la plus petite unité

d'information manipulable par une machine numérique.

Avec un bit on peut avoir soit 1, soit 0.

Avec 2 bits on peut avoir quatre états différents (2*2):

0 0

0 1

1 0

1 1

0 1

Avec 3 bits on peut avoir huit états différents (2*2*2):

Page 18: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 18/23

18

0 0 0

0 0 1

0 1 00 1 1

1 0 0

1 0 1

1 1 0

1 1 1

Avec huit bits on a 2*2*2*2*2*2*2*2=256 possibilités, c'est ce que l'on appelle un octet.

27 =128 26 =64 25 =32 24 =16 23 =8 22 =4 21 =2 20 =1

0 0 0 0 0 0 0 0

1 1 1 1 1 1 1 1

Le plus petit nombre est 0, le plus grand est 255, il y a donc 256 possibilités

Cette notion peut être étendue à n bits, on a alors 2n possibilités.

5 L' t t

Page 19: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 19/23

19

5. L'octet

L'octet est une unité d'information composée de 8 bits. Il permet de stocker un caractère, telle qu'une lettre, un chiffre..

Ce regroupement de nombres par série de 8 permet une lisibilité plus grande

Une unité d'information composée de 16 bits est généralement appelée mot (en anglais word )

Une unité d'information de 32 bits de longueur est appelée double mot (en anglais double word , d'où l'appelation dword ).

6. KiloOctets

Un kilo-octet (Ko) = 1024 octets

7. MégaOctets

Un méga-octet (Mo) =1024 Ko=1 048 576 octets

8. Les opérations en binaire

Les opérations arithmétiques simples telles que l'addition, la soustraction et la multiplication sont faciles

à effectuer en binaire.

Page 20: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 20/23

Page 21: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 21/23

21

Page 22: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 22/23

22

Des Questions ?Des Questions ?Des Questions ?

Page 23: Architecture Ordinateur 2008 p1

8/14/2019 Architecture Ordinateur 2008 p1

http://slidepdf.com/reader/full/architecture-ordinateur-2008-p1 23/23

23

Réalisé Par : EL HAIDAOUI Youssef 

Ingénieur En Informatique

Prof En Informatique Depuis 2001

Email : [email protected]

Tel : 0021266950863